I was in a SF suite on the Gem earlier this month and got the call a month before we sailed. The call comes from a concierge area on land not the concierge on board David or his assistant. The call is pretty much worthless as "Leatham" did nothing we asked for.

 

Don't even give it a second thought as it will just tick you off on board when your preferences are ignored.

 

Go and enjoy yourself. David will take care of you on board.
